Monitor AWS S3 buckets for new files from Python with boto3

import boto3 | |
import os | |
import sys | |
import string | |
import random | |
import logging | |
import time | |
import json | |
import urllib | |
from threading import Thread | |
import tempfile | |
from pathlib import Path | |
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__) | |
logger.setLevel(logging.INFO) | |
log_fmt_long = logging.Formatter( | |
fmt='%(asctime)s %(name)s %(levelname)s: %(message)s', | |
datefmt='%Y-%m-%d %H:%M:%S' | |
) | |
log_handler_stream = logging.StreamHandler(sys.stdout) | |
log_handler_stream.setFormatter(log_fmt_long) | |
log_handler_stream.setLevel(logging.INFO) | |
logger.addHandler(log_handler_stream) | |
BUCKET_NAME = 'test-bucket-' + ''.join(random.choice(string.ascii_lowercase) for i in range(10)) | |
QUEUE_NAME = 's3-bucket-monitor-' + ''.join(random.choice(string.ascii_lowercase) for i in range(10)) | |
client_options = { | |
'aws_access_key_id': os.environ['AWS_ACCESS_KEY_ID'], | |
'aws_secret_access_key': os.environ['AWS_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Y'], | |
'region_name': os.environ.get('AWS_REGION', 'us-east-1'), | |
} | |
s3_client = boto3.client('s3', **client_options) | |
sqs_client = boto3.client('sqs', **client_options) | |
class BucketUploaderThread(Thread): | |
def __init__(self): | |
super().__init__() | |
self._should_exit: bool = False | |
@property | |
def should_exit(self): | |
return self._should_exit | |
@should_exit.setter | |
def should_exit(self, value: bool): | |
self._should_exit = value | |
def run(self): | |
counter = 0 | |
with tempfile.TemporaryDirectory() as tempdir: | |
while True: | |
if self.should_exit: | |
return | |
our_file = Path(tempdir, f'test_{counter}') | |
counter += 1 | |
our_file.write_text('ignore me') | |
try: | |
logger.info(f'Uploading {our_file.name}') | |
s3_client.upload_file(str(our_file), BUCKET_NAME, our_file.name) | |
except Exception: | |
logger.exception(f'Could not upload {our_file.name}') | |
# three seconds between uploads | |
time.sleep(3) | |
bucket_uploader_thread = BucketUploaderThread() | |
def cleanup(): | |
# stop thread | |
logger.info('Stopping thread') | |
bucket_uploader_thread.should_exit = True | |
time.sleep(4) | |
# delete bucket and everything in it | |
try: | |
logger.info(f'Deleting bucket {BUCKET_NAME}') | |
paginator = s3_client.get_paginator('list_objects_v2') | |
page_iterator = paginator.paginate(Bucket=BUCKET_NAME) | |
for page in page_iterator: | |
if 'Contents' in page: | |
for content in page['Contents']: | |
key = content['Key'] | |
s3_client.delete_object(Bucket=BUCKET_NAME, Key=content['Key']) | |
s3_client.delete_bucket(Bucket=BUCKET_NAME) | |
except Exception: | |
logger.exception('Could not delete bucket') | |
# delete queue | |
if 'queue_url' in globals(): | |
logger.info(f'Deleting queue {QUEUE_NAME}') | |
try: | |
sqs_client.delete_queue(QueueUrl=globals()['queue_url']) | |
except Exception: | |
logger.exception('Could not delete queue') | |
sys.exit(0) | |
# create a bucket | |
try: | |
logger.info(f'Creating bucket {BUCKET_NAME}') | |
if client_options['region_name'] == "us-east-1": | |
s3_client.create_bucket(Bucket=BUCKET_NAME) | |
else: | |
location = {"LocationConstraint": client_options['region_name']} | |
s3_client.create_bucket( | |
Bucket=BUCKET_NAME, | |
CreateBucketConfiguration=location, | |
) | |
except Exception: | |
logger.exception('Could not create bucket') | |
cleanup() | |
# create a queue | |
try: | |
logger.info(f'Creating queue {QUEUE_NAME}') | |
queue_url = sqs_client.create_queue(QueueName=QUEUE_NAME)['QueueUrl'] | |
except Exception: | |
logger.exception('Could not create queue') | |
cleanup() | |
# sleep 1 second to make sure the queue is available | |
time.sleep(1) | |
# get queue ARN | |
try: | |
logger.info(f'Getting queue arn for {QUEUE_NAME}') | |
queue_arn = sqs_client.get_queue_attributes(QueueUrl=queue_url, AttributeNames=['QueueArn'])['Attributes']['QueueArn'] | |
except Exception: | |
logger.exception('Could not get queue arn') | |
cleanup() | |
# set queue policy | |
sqs_policy = { | |
"Version": "2012-10-17", | |
"Id": "example-ID", | |
"Statement": [ | |
{ | |
"Sid": "Monitor-SQS-ID", | |
"Effect": "Allow", | |
"Principal": { | |
"AWS":"*" | |
}, | |
"Action": [ | |
"SQS:SendMessage" | |
], | |
"Resource": queue_arn, | |
"Condition": { | |
"ArnLike": { | |
"aws:SourceArn": f"arn:aws:s3:*:*:{BUCKET_NAME}" | |
}, | |
} | |
} | |
] | |
} | |
try: | |
logger.info('Setting queue attributes') | |
sqs_client.set_queue_attributes( | |
QueueUrl=queue_url, | |
Attributes={ | |
'Policy': json.dumps(sqs_policy), | |
} | |
) | |
except exception as e: | |
logger.exception('could not set queue attributes') | |
cleanup() | |
# configure the bucket notification system | |
try: | |
logger.info(f'Setting bucket notification configuration') | |
bucket_notification_config = { | |
'QueueConfigurations': [ | |
{ | |
'QueueArn': queue_arn, | |
'Events': [ | |
's3:ObjectCreated:*', | |
] | |
} | |
], | |
} | |
s3_client.put_bucket_notification_configuration( | |
Bucket=BUCKET_NAME, | |
NotificationConfiguration=bucket_notification_config | |
) | |
except exception as e: | |
logger.exception('could not set bucket notification configuration') | |
cleanup() | |
# start a thread that starts uploading files to the bucket | |
bucket_uploader_thread.start() | |
# start a while loop to monitor the queue for new messages. Kill it with Ctrl-C | |
try: | |
logger.info('Infinite while loop starting. Press Ctrl-C to terminate') | |
while True: | |
try: | |
resp = sqs_client.receive_message( | |
QueueUrl=queue_url, | |
AttributeNames=['All'], | |
MaxNumberOfMessages=10, | |
WaitTimeSeconds=10, | |
) | |
except Exception as e: | |
cleanup() | |
if 'Messages' not in resp: | |
logger.info('No messages found') | |
continue | |
for message in resp['Messages']: | |
body = json.loads(message['Body']) | |
# we are going to assume 1 record per message | |
try: | |
record = body['Records'][0] | |
event_name = record['eventName'] | |
except Exception as e: | |
logger.info(f'Ignoring {message=} because of {str(e)}') | |
continue | |
if event_name.startswith('ObjectCreated'): | |
# new file created! | |
s3_info = record['s3'] | |
object_info = s3_info['object'] | |
key = urllib.parse.unquote_plus(object_info['key']) | |
logger.info(f'Found new object {key}') | |
# delete messages from the queue | |
entries = [ | |
{'Id': msg['MessageId'], 'ReceiptHandle': msg['ReceiptHandle']} | |
for msg in resp['Messages'] | |
] | |
try: | |
resp = sqs_client.delete_message_batch( | |
QueueUrl=queue_url, Entries=entries | |
) | |
except Exception as e: | |
cleanup() | |
if len(resp['Successful']) != len(entries): | |
logger.warn(f"Failed to delete messages: entries={entries!r} resp={resp!r}") | |
except KeyboardInterrupt: | |
logger.info('Ctrl-C caught!') | |
cleanup() |
